We took our teen and close church boys on a campout. Decided to just go to the lake in light of prolly be too high to let them float at Tyler Bend which was the original plan. With the way most of these guys drove boats, it was a good option.

We paddled about 1/2 a mile up an inlet on the lake as it narrowed down to what must have been a neat creek in pre-lake days. Me, rpm max, Q in the 2fun and 2 canoes full of boys. Nice 4 foot fall and all kinds of crazy squirrely water along side the main current below it. We had to drag over some rocks to get up to it.

Big eddy along one bank would pull you almost to the bottom of the fall. Q was gettin braver, doing great as he would ferry and s turn but slacking off to hit the opposite eddy. I warned him.. paddle on across... "I am." But he wasn't. Finally. Squirrely water stopped him, current grabbed his stern. Hello fishies.

One of the boys was loving it. He went thru 3 others in my buffy barge (big retired rental Buffalo canoe) with him in the bow doing the loop over and over. One would get out he would recruit another to go with him. Couldn't get enough. I may have created a wwater junkie??? Up to the fall spin around, come whooshing out, had to cut hard to miss a rock then back to the eddy to go again.

Q got over the scared and was back at it. Go boy. Tilting the boat well. Had to pass this story to a few as actually he was very excited about it. Did not come out of the water that way, but by last night we were hearing it over and over as he tried to understand what he did. After he got over the shock he was back in the boat and trying again. Soon shooting for the same eddy that did him in.

A little impromtu boatball in our yaks, 2 boys swimming and 2 in a wally world raft. I think we all had to go home and sleep it off. So while I began the weekend almost whining that I could not go with my son to hit some ample water, it all was good in the end. What a day!
